It's nearly five years since the Edgeware Village Master Plan for the recovery of St Albans was agreed on but nothing much has happened to implement that. Then out of the blue the Christchurch City Council decides that stopping northbound traffic on Colombo St from entering Edgeware Rd and on to Cranford St might be a good idea. Consultation has started and business owners are none to happy about the proposal. All this and lots more in the April/May issue, being delivered to central St Albans letterboxes over the next week by our volunteers.
